Msm 8255 block diagram software

We will first learn how the pins of the 8255 ic are set or reset while it is in the bsr mode and what. Group a and b get the control signal from cpu and send the command to the individual control blocks. Microcomputer block diagram c p u r a m r o m in te rfa c e c irc u it ry p e rip h era l d e v ice s a d d re s s b u s d a ta b u s c o n tro l b u s f11. The readwrite control logic manages all of the internal and external transfers of both data and control words. Computer engineering assignment help, draw and elucidate the block diagram 8259, draw and elucidate the block diagram of programmable interrupt controller 8259. Use pdf export for high quality prints and svg export for large sharp images or embed your diagrams. This tristate bidirectional buffer is used to interface the internal data bus of 8255 pin diagram to the system data bus. Stbbar input is connected to external peripherals strobe output i. Choose the intel 8255xbased pci ethernet adapter 10100 out of the list. The bsr mode of 8255 ppi programmable peripheral interface. The intel 8255a is a general purpose programmable io device. Interfacing 8086 assembly language digital to analog converter.

Coma mobile station modem msm asic architecture, design approaches, goals and methodology. It can be used to transfer data under various condition from simple inputoutput to interrupt inputoutput. It has 16 analog channels which can either be configured as 16 single ended inputs, or 8 differential inputs. Oct 16, 2017 8255 a block diagram in hindi moh maya. In the analog front end, the pulser provides a high voltage impulse to the transducer at a select. The internal block diagram and the pin configuration of 8255. Programmable peripheral interface 8255 basics, control signals, block diagram. The block diagram of the 8051 microcontroller architecture shows that 8051 microcontroller consists of a cpu, ram sfrs and data memory, flash eeprom, io ports and control logic for communication between the peripherals.

The leader in dsp solutions 11 tms320c203lc203 block diagram a150 d150 serial port sync io ports 64k. All of these ports can function independently either as input or as output ports. The intel 8255a is a general purpose programmable io device which is designed for use with all intel and most other microprocessors. How many ports are there in 8255 and what are they ans. The 8251 and 8253 study card incorporates intels 8251 and 8253. Programmable peripheral interface 8255 geeksforgeeks.

Programmable peripheral interface the 8255a is a general purpose programmable io device designed for use with intel microprocessors. Functional block of 8255 edit the 8255 has 24 inputoutput pins in all. A high on this input clears the control register and all ports a, b, c are set to the input mode. Ppi 8255 interface with 8085 datasheet, cross reference, circuit and application notes in pdf format. Sim card interface block diagram electronic products. When the signal is low, the microprocessor reads the data from the selected io port of the 8255. The internal block diagram and the pin configuration of. The 8bit data bus buffer is controlled by the readwrite control logic. The 8254 is a programmable interval timercounter designed for use with intel microcomputer systems. Mimo system block diagram matlab jobs, employment freelancer. Block diagram of io interfacing access one port at a time 8bit registers io ports are associated with a sfr. Draw and elucidate the block diagram 8259, computer engineering. This is economical, functional, flexible but is a little complex and general purpose io device that can be used with almost any microprocessor. Intel 8255a pin description let us first take a look at the pin diagram of intel 8255a.

Following the isoiec 78163, isoiec 781612 and etsi ts 102221 standards, all mobile phones are manufactured using sim or universal integrated circuit card uicc smart cards. Bit set reset bsr mode this mode is used to set or reset the bits of port c only, and selected when the most significant bit d7 in the. The interface is designed to explain all the facilities available in 8251 and 8253. Pcdio96 8255 program peripheral interface with relays 8255ppi cb50lp 8255 ppi intel ppi 8255 control word 8255 ppi dpb2 dpc2 text. Figure 2 is a parallelin, serialout shift register w a series of andorinverter gates that are used to establish preset and clear conditions when the load signal is activated a circuit like the one in. It consists of data bus buffer, control logic and group a and group b controls. Coma mobile station modem msm asic architecture, design approaches, goals and methodology hotchips v august 1993 jurg hinderling tim rueth ken easton dawn eagleson jeff levin daniel kindred richard kerr qualcomm incorporated 10555sorrento valley road san diego, ca 92121 qi overview overview ofmsm system architecture. Block diagram of programmable peripheral interface 8255 4.

Mode 1 strobed inputoutput mode 2 strobed bidirectional bus io the functional configuration of the d8255 is programmed by the system software, so that normally no external logic is needed to. The mc6802 is completely software compatible with the mc6800 as well as. Explain in brief various modes of operation with the help of its control register contents. The intels 8255 is designed for use with intels 8bit, 16bit and higher capability microprocessors. It has 3 independent counters, each capable of handling clock inputs up to 10 mhz and size of each counter is 16 bit. Each point on the map indicates the location of a soil survey area for which a block diagram is available online. The parallel inputoutput port chip 8255 is also called as programmable peripheral input output port. Used to interface between 8255 data bus with system bus. It consists of three 8bit bidirectional io ports 24io lines which can be configured as per the.

The fastest way to become a software developer duration. Qualcomm snapdragon mobile platforms, processors, modems and. We can program it according to the given condition. Ppi 8255 is a general purpose programmable io device designed to interface the cpu.

Oct 20, 2017 the following image shows the 8051 microcontroller architecture in a block diagram style. Part, manufacturer, description, pdf, samples, ordering. Write a program to initialize 8255 in the configuration below. The internal block diagram and the pin configuration of 8255 are shown in fig. Use createlys easy online diagram editor to edit this diagram, collaborate with others and export results to multiple image. It is a general purpose, multitiming element that can be treated as an array of io ports in the system software. This tristate bidirectional buffer is used to interface the internal data lilts of 8255. Programmable peripheral interface 8255 basics, control signals. This controller converts parallel data from the processor to serial data and transmits it and converts the serial. Sim card interface block diagram nxp offers a tailored portfolio to protect usim interfaces from esd discharges and emi interference, in terms of radiation and injection. A block diagram of a typical contemporary ultrasonic flaw detector is seen below. The 8254 is an advanced version of 8253 which did not offered the feature of read back command.

The intel 8255 or i8255 programmable peripheral interface ppi chip was developed and. In this lecture we focus on 8255 a programmable peripheral interface. Interface an 8255 chip with 8086 to work as an io port. The 8259a is fully upward compatible with the intel 8259. What are the functions of ports in microprocessor peripherals. You can edit this template and create your own diagram. Files are available under licenses specified on their description page. Programmable peripheral interface 8255 ppi 8255 is a general purpose programmable io device designed to interface the cpu with its outside world such as adc, dac, keyboard etc. While most data that is input or output from your computer is processed by the cpu, some data does not require processing, or can be processed by another device. It can be expanded to 64 interrupt requests by employing one master 8259a and 8 slave units.

Peripheral interfis a peripheral chip originallace chip y developed for the intel 8085 mcroproi cessor, and as such is a member of a large array of such chips, known as the mcs85 family. It is programmed to work with either 8085 or 8086 processor. Fig below shows the internal block diagram of the 8259a. The 8255a is a general purpose programmable io device designed to transfer the data from io to interrupt io under certain conditions as required. The data bus buffer allows the 8085 to send control words to the 8259a and read a status word from the 8259 block diagram. This can be achieved by programming the bits of an internal register of 8255 called as control word register cwr. All structured data from the file and property namespaces is available under the creative commons cc0 license. It was first available in a 40pin dip and later a 44pin plcc packages. The points do not indicate a specific location illustrated by a diagram. There are 5 hardware interrupts and 2 hardware interrupts in 8085 and 8086. Functional description of 8251 and 8253, implementation of the circuit and some simple software.

Microprocessor 8255 programmable peripheral interface. Adc interfacing with 8085 ppi 8255 8155 intel microprocessor block diagram. This page was last edited on 29 november 2016, at 12. Qualcomm snapdragon mobile platforms, processors, modems. Offer msm 82550904pnspmt040ab qualcomm from kynix semiconductor hong kong limited. It consists of three 8bit bidirectional io ports 24io lines which can be configured as per the requirement. The intel 8253 and 8254 are programmable interval timers pits, which perform timing and counting functions using three 16bit counters the 825x family was primarily designed for the intel 80808085processors, but later used in x86 compatible systems. Block diagram of 8255 ppi read write control logic data bus buffer group a control group a. Its function is that of a general purposes io component to interface peripheral equipment to the microcomputer system bush. The intel 8253 and 8254 are programmable interval timers pits, which perform timing and counting functions using three 16bit counters the 825x family was primarily designed for the intel 80808085. This tristate bidirectional buffer is used to interface the internal data lilts of 8255 to the system data bus. Working of programmable peripheral interface 8255 5. Qualcomm invents breakthrough technologies and products that fuel the invention age.

Psaddon 8255 interface card is designed to study the features of intel 8255. It found wide applicability in digital processing systems and was later cloned. It manage 8 interrupts according to the instructions written into its control registers. The 8255 has 24 io pins divided into 3 groups of 8 pins each. In this article, we are going to study the working of 8255 ppi in the bsr mode. Every one of the ports can be configured as either an input port or an output port. Group a and group b controls the functional configuration of each port is programmed by the systems software. Datasheet the 82c55a is a high performance cmos version of the industry standard 8255a and is manufactured using a selfaligned silicon gate cmos process scaled saji iv. The qualcomm snapdragon mobile platforms include our most power efficient mobile processorsbuilt to enable immersive experiences, lightningfast connectivity, and cuttingedge performance. We compare the specs of the qualcomm s2 msm8255 to see how it stacks up against its competitors including the stericsson novathor u8500, qualcomm snapdragon s4 play msm8225 and qualcomm snapdragon 800. Key features block diagram software compatible with the intel 8255. Thus the assembly language program to interface 8086 with 8255. Mode 1 strobed inputoutput mode 2 strobed bidirectional bus io the functional configuration of the d8255 is programmed by the system software, so that normally no external logic is needed to interface peripheral devices or structures. Creately is an easy to use diagram and flowchart software built for team collaboration.

That is to say, i need to be able to draw a toplevel block diagram, but then also expand each block to show whats under the hood, as many levels deep as happens to be necessary. This chip was later also used with the intel 8086 and its. Nov 02, 2014 i am looking for block diagram software for windows that behaves similarly to the simulink editor. Coma mobile station modem msm asic architecture, design. May 06, 2008 hi, im just going to quote the whole word problem bc i dont fully understand it. Software originally written for the 8259 will operate the 8259a in all 8259 equivalent modes mcs8085, nonbuffered, edge triggered. Programmable peripheral interface 8255 1 architecture of 8255. The groups are denoted by port a, port b and port c respectively. The 8259a adds 8 vectored priority encoded interrupts to microprocessor. User manual for 8255 interface card pantech solutions. The 8255a is a programmable peripheral interface ppi device designed for use in intel microcomputer systems. Creately diagrams can be exported and added to word, ppt powerpoint, excel, visio or any other document. The function of this block is to manage all of the internal and external transfers of both data and. Dma stands for direct memory access and is a method of transferring data from the computers ram to another part of the computer without processing it using the cpu.

369 398 872 403 1356 24 164 787 308 1027 250 1253 598 694 949 1178 40 97 89 146 440 216 1128 247 162 1433 1331 932 1183